APK: Explorando o Mundo dos Arquivos Android
No universo dos dispositivos móveis, os aplicativos são uma das principais formas de interagir com smartphones e tablets. O Android, sendo uma das plataformas mais populares, utiliza um formato específico de arquivo para aplicativos: o APK ou Android Package. Este artigo aborda o que é um APK, sua importância e o que os usuários devem saber ao lidar com eles.
O Que é um APK?
APK é a sigla para Android Package, um formato de arquivo utilizado para a distribuição e instalação de aplicativos em dispositivos Android. Essencialmente, um APK é um pacote que contém todos os elementos necessários para que um aplicativo funcione, incluindo o código-fonte compilado, recursos de mídia, certificados e um manifesto.
Estrutura de um Arquivo APK
Um arquivo APK é, na verdade, um arquivo compactado que segue a estrutura de um arquivo ZIP. Dentro desse pacote, existem componentes essenciais, como:
- AndroidManifest.xml: Um arquivo XML que descreve os componentes do aplicativo e as permissões necessárias.
- classes.dex: Contém os arquivos compilados em formato Dalvik Executable, que são executados na máquina virtual Dalvik.
- resources.arsc: Um arquivo binário contendo recursos de aplicações, como strings e layouts.
- Assets e Res: Diretórios que contêm recursos adicionais, como imagens e layouts.
Importância dos APKs no Desenvolvimento Android
Desenvolvedores de aplicativos Android dependem de APKs durante o fluxo de trabalho de desenvolvimento. Criar e distribuir um APK é a última etapa no ciclo de desenvolvimento, permitindo que os aplicativos sejam testados em dispositivos reais ou emuladores. APKs também facilitam a distribuição de aplicativos fora da Google Play Store, possibilitando o uso de lojas alternativas ou distribuição direta.
Vantagens dos APKs
Os APKs oferecem inúmeras vantagens:
- Instalação Offline: Usuários podem instalar aplicativos sem acesso à internet.
- Controle de Atualizações: Permite a instalação de versões específicas dos aplicativos, útil em situações onde a última versão não é desejada.
- Disponibilidade Global: Permite acessar aplicativos não disponíveis na Google Play Store de determinadas regiões.
Pontos de Atenção ao Lidar com APKs
Embora os APKs ofereçam flexibilidade, é vital considerá-los com cautela:
- Segurança: Baixar APKs de fontes não confiáveis pode introduzir malware ou aplicativos maliciosos no dispositivo.
- Permissões: É crucial revisar as permissões que o aplicativo solicita, garantindo que não haja solicitações desnecessárias ou invasivas.
AABC22 e Atração por APKs Customizados
A tendência de personalização de dispositivos Android, conhecida como AABC22 no nicho de tecnologia, incentiva usuários a explorar APKs customizados. Estes APKs trazem personalizações avançadas não encontradas em pacotes padrão, mas devem ser abordados com cautela devido a possíveis riscos de segurança.
Como Instalar Arquivos APK em Dispositivos Android
Para instalar um APK, é necessário ajustar algumas configurações no dispositivo Android:
- Navegar para Configurações > Segurança.
- Ativar a opção "Fontes desconhecidas" para permitir a instalação de aplicativos de fontes externas.
- Baixar o arquivo APK desejado e executá-lo para iniciar a instalação.
Após a instalação, recomenda-se desativar a opção "Fontes desconhecidas" para evitar a instalação acidental de aplicativos indesejados.
Conclusão
Os arquivos APK são um componente crucial do ecossistema Android, oferecendo flexibilidade e liberdade tanto para usuários quanto para desenvolvedores. Apesar dos benefícios, é essencial lidar com APKs de maneira responsável para evitar riscos de segurança. Seja explorando novas customizações com AABC22 ou apenas instalando um aplicativo de forma mais direta, entender o funcionamento dos APKs é vital para aproveitar ao máximo a plataforma Android.